Transaction 64050a85ef65415aded325e63faabf478634534c1afa085b32fb3eafeb5b1568
1 Input
1 Output
-
64050a85ef65415aded325e63faabf478634534c1afa085b32fb3eafeb5b1568:0
- value
- 9928377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fec99942ee27c4a973e0f23a78421de809c16d14 OP_EQUAL
- address
- 3QvD4bCDvDy9sd7ykZgnQVcyMrd8ivrVwj